Operation Underground Railroad and Fight To End Exploitation share how traffickers upload sexual abuse material on to porn websites, for unsuspecting audiences.
The pornography industry fuels the demand for human sex trafficking, rescue experts warn. FOX News Digital talked to Operation Underground Railroad and Fight To End Exploitation, which devote their resources to helping victims of abuse, and they revealed that videos of sexual abuse often end up on pornography websites to unsuspecting audiences.
